What is Flexibility?

Flexibility refers to the range of motion in a joint or series of joints, and it is determined by a combination of factors, including the length of the muscles, tendons, and ligaments, as well as the shape and structure of the bones. When we talk about flexibility, we are referring to the ability of the joints to move freely and easily, without restriction or discomfort. Good flexibility allows for a full range of motion, enabling us to perform daily activities with ease and efficiency, while poor flexibility can lead to stiffness, limited mobility, and increased risk of injury.

Benefits of Flexibility

The benefits of flexibility are numerous and well-documented. For one, flexibility helps to improve posture, reducing the risk of back and neck pain, as well as other musculoskeletal disorders. It also enhances athletic performance, allowing for more efficient and effective movement, and reducing the risk of injury. Additionally, flexibility can help to reduce muscle soreness and improve recovery after exercise, making it an essential component of any fitness routine. Furthermore, flexibility has been shown to improve balance and coordination, reducing the risk of falls and other accidents, particularly in older adults.

How Flexibility Affects the Body

Flexibility affects the body in a number of ways, from the muscles and joints to the nervous system and overall physiology. When we stretch, we are lengthening the muscles and tendons, increasing the range of motion in the joints, and improving the overall flexibility of the body. This, in turn, can help to reduce muscle tension and improve circulation, allowing for more efficient delivery of oxygen and nutrients to the muscles. Flexibility also affects the nervous system, helping to regulate the length-tension relationship of the muscles, and improving the overall coordination and balance of the body.

The Relationship Between Flexibility and Other Fitness Components

Flexibility is closely linked to other components of fitness, including strength, endurance, and coordination. For example, good flexibility is essential for maintaining proper form and technique during strength training exercises, reducing the risk of injury and improving overall effectiveness. Similarly, flexibility is important for endurance activities, such as running and cycling, where it can help to improve efficiency and reduce the risk of overuse injuries. Additionally, flexibility is closely linked to coordination and balance, helping to regulate the movement of the body and reduce the risk of accidents and injuries.

Age-Related Changes in Flexibility

Flexibility naturally declines with age, due to a combination of factors, including the loss of muscle mass and strength, the shortening of muscles and tendons, and the degeneration of joints. This decline in flexibility can lead to a range of problems, from reduced mobility and increased risk of falls, to decreased athletic performance and reduced overall quality of life. However, this decline is not inevitable, and regular stretching and flexibility exercises can help to maintain and even improve flexibility, regardless of age.

Measuring Flexibility

Flexibility can be measured in a number of ways, including the use of flexibility tests, such as the sit-and-reach test, and the assessment of range of motion in the joints. These tests can provide valuable information about an individual's flexibility, helping to identify areas of strength and weakness, and informing the development of effective stretching and flexibility programs. Additionally, advances in technology, such as 3D motion analysis and electromyography, are allowing for more detailed and accurate assessments of flexibility, providing new insights into the complex relationships between flexibility, movement, and overall fitness.

Incorporating Flexibility into Your Fitness Routine

Incorporating flexibility into your fitness routine is easier than you might think. Start by setting aside time each day to stretch, focusing on major muscle groups, such as the hamstrings, quadriceps, and hip flexors. You can also incorporate flexibility exercises into your existing workout routine, using techniques, such as dynamic stretching, to improve flexibility and reduce the risk of injury. Additionally, consider working with a fitness professional or physical therapist to develop a personalized flexibility program, tailored to your specific needs and goals.
